8/19/23 - Day 67 - Things are still looking good. We just had a water change. A couple more weeks! 8/21/23 - OK, ok ok, we have a lot of work coming up. Right now is like the calm before the storm. The storm I'm talking about is harvest, trimming, drying, and curing. This is the kind of labor that you LOVE to HATE. Especially with how many buds ill be pulling from this LEAF box. Let's talk about progress real fast. She is getting bulkier every day. Overnight she drank about 300+ ppm of nutes. She likes the nutes a lot. I'm taking this as a reason for all the little snowy crystals and the enlargement of the buds. Flushing: For about a week before harvest I will empty the water+Nutes and refill only with Water. We want the plant to suck up and replace all the nutes in the buds with water. This is called flushing. Trimming plans and Tools: When it's time to trim the plant, I've got a plan in mind. I'm going to trim the buds while they're still wet, and I'll leave them attached to the stems. To simplify the drying process, I will split the LEAF into two parts – the top and the bottom. Since space is a bit tight in the LEAF with this grow, I will keep just the buds on the branches. This will help the air circulate the buds better. I've even found this cool trimming tray on Amazon that I'm planning to use. I've realized that having the right tools for trimming is essential. Just like I'd put on gloves to work on a car, I will use nitrile gloves to keep things clean while trimming. And I'll use proper trimming scissors instead of regular ones. These scissors are designed for this job and should make the process much smoother. Amazon - Trimming Tray - (somewherr brand pictured above) Amazon - Nitrile Gloves Amazon - Trimming Scissors Drying Plans and Tools: Once I'm done trimming, it's time to dry the buds. I'm thinking of using simple tension rods, like those small shower curtain rods, to hang the branches. This way, I can create two levels inside the drying box. The lower part can rest on a SCROG net to ensure good airflow and even drying for all the branches. The LEAF box will handle the drying parameters. The environment inside the LEAF box will focus only on keeping the humidity at 60% and moving the air around getting the buds to a non-mildew amount of humidity. Amazon - Tension rods 16-28” Curing Plans and Tools After the buds are dry (60% humidity), the next step is curing. This means I'll be storing the buds in sealed glass jars. I've got mason jars and hygrometers to monitor humidity levels. Once the jars are filled with buds, I'll seal them and put them in an cool, dark spot. I plan to open the jars briefly every day to let in some fresh air. (15min). I'll know the curing is done when the humidity inside the jars stays around 62% during these "burps." That's when my perfectly cured buds will be ready to enjoy! Amazon - Hygrometer 12 Pack Target - 32oz Ball Mason Jars 12 Pack I use a smell-proof duffle bag. Hello Everyone 👏, As you can see, are all Cherry Colas growing, they all have a tightrips in their pots for now, for recognition. Will make nicer pictures of them in a few days. They are now 4 days from germination🙏. The humidifier had been added, so I had to adjust the room a lil bit. Seedlings don't need much nutrients, neighter do autoflowers. with normal soil I would recommend to only give water for 1-2 weeks, since it holds nutrients in it as well. But since I'm using Cocos for this grow, I might have to add some basic nutrients in the upcomming week. For this week I gave/give only water turns and Startbooster turns. Update day 5: - Lowerd the lights to avoid stretching. they are now at 75cm distance from lamp to pots. I want them at 40-50 cm, but I don't want to rush it. - Added another layer of cocos to avoid the soil from drying up therefore the roots from dying. This will happen because of lowering the lamps down, the soil will get exposed more to heat. As you can see, the humidifier is doing his thing haha.
